Resonant photoluminescence of a two-dimensional electron system upon the formation of a bulk 1/3 state of the fractional Hall effect

Abstract: Resonant and nonresonant photoluminescence spectra of a two-dimensional electron system have been studied under the conditions of the formation of the 1/3 fractional quantum Hall effect state. It has been shown that resonant photoluminescence, in contrast to nonresonant photoluminescence, is a universal marker of the formation of the 1/3 state in the bulk of the two-dimensional system. It has been found that the probabilities of optical transitions from the zeroth Landau level of electrons in the 1/3 state vary so strongly that these variations cannot be explained within the existence theoretical concepts.
